Q:   What are the prospects for an Aviation student in the future?
A: 

With a constantly growing global economy, the aviation sector is booming. Future prospects for aviation students in Canada will be plentiful, both inside and outside of the aviation industry. Just a few instances are shown below: 

There is a high demand for qualified personnel due to the Aviation industry's rapid growth. This implies that there will be more jobs available in the future for aviation students.
The technology used to operate aircraft has advanced significantly over time. As a result, you might consider a job as a pilot, flight engineer, or systems engineer in the aviation industry.
Environmentally friendly practices are becoming more prevalent in the aviation industry. This implies that you could work in a field that emphasises minimising environmental impact, such as aircraft design or maintenance.

Q:   Is a career in aviation worth it?
A: 

A job in aviation comes with a lot of responsibility; yet, it is well worth the effort, but there are some things candidates should know before entering this field as a professional. That needs a significant investment, so if candidates don't have enough, they will be out of work. It necessitates that candidates be medically fit, not only once in their career. Candidates must exercise on a regular basis and be mentally fit as well. They are responsible for everyone on board.
Yet the thrill candidates experience when they are in the air makes it all worthwhile. It's a different experience every time. And, of course, when it comes to paying, it's more than adequate and well-paying work.
